The Barnegat 20 is a classic small sailboat, designed by James E. Graves and built by Graves Yacht Yard in Marblehead, Massachusetts. Produced between 1960 and 1970, this compact monohull was conceived as a versatile vessel, suitable for coastal cruising and day sailing. Its design reflects the builder's long-standing commitment to traditional boat construction and quality craftsmanship, hallmarks of a yard deeply rooted in America's maritime heritage.
